2、deral agencies. 1. SCOPE. This commercial item description (CID) covers vibrating head metal disintegrators intended for use in removing broken taps, drills, reamers, bolts, screws or in taking core samples from metals undergoing tests. 2. CLASSIFICATION. The metal disintegrator shall be of the foll
3、owing types. The type to be furnished shall be as specified (see 7.2(b). Type I - Drill press mounted Type II - Portable mounted Type III - Table mounted 3. SALIENT CHARACTERISTICS 3.1 General reauirements. The metal disintegrator shail be new and one of the manufacturers current models capable of o
4、peration in accordance with the requirements herein. All parts subject to wear, breakage. or distortion shall be accessible for adjustment, replacement, and repair. 3.2 Components. Type I metal disintegrators shall consist of a vibrating head having a 0.5-inch arbor for mounting into the chuck of a
5、drill press, a power supply, and a coolant system. Type II metal disintegrators shall consist of a vibrating head, a power supply, a coolant system. and a superstructure. Type III metal disintegrators shall consist of a vibrating head, a power supply, a coolant system, a superstructure, and a workta
6、ble. 3.2.1 Vibrating head. The vibrating head shall conduct continuous electric pulses to the electrode that shail cause an electric arc between the electrode and the workpiece, resulting in disintegration of the workpiece. The vibrating head shall hold the electrode by means of coliets or a tool ho

The metal disintegrator shall allow for manual advancement of the electrode i
9、nto the workpiece. Unless otherwise specified (see 7.2(c), the quill travel within the vibrating head of the type II and III metal disintegrators shall not be less than 3 inches and 9 inches, respectively. When specified (see 7.2(d), the metal disintegrator shall have an automatic feed system that a
10、dvances the electrode into the workpiece by means of either a pneumatic or electrical servomechanism. The automatic feed system shall sense the electrode current and control the feed rate for optimum metal removal. 3.2.2 Power supdv. The power supply shall provide control ofthe voltage and current f
11、lowing through the electrode in the vibrating head to the workpiece. Unless otherwise specified (see 7.3(e), cables connecting the power supply to the vibrating head of type I or II metal disintegrators shall be not less than 8 feet in length. The power supply shaii be equipped with a ground huit in
12、terrupt circuit breaker. 3.2.3 Coolant system. The coolant system shall filter and pump water through the electrode. remove metal particles, and facilitate the metal disintegration process. 3.2.4 Suuerstructure. The type II or type III metal disintegrator shaU have a superstructure that supports and
13、 maintains the position of the vibrating head during operation. The superstructure shall consist of a base. a column. and a crossarm. The superstructure shall permit rotation of the vibrating head in a plane perpendicular to the crossarm and rotation in a plane parallel to the crossarm. The base sha
14、ll support the column and provide a means of attachment of the superstructure to either a table or other large metal surface. The type II metal disintegrator shall have a base that allows the superstmcture to be magnetically attached to a large system fiom which a broken boit or tap is to be removed
15、. The type III metal disintegrator shall have either a magnetic base or a base bolted to the superstructure as specified (see 7.2(f). The force exerted by the magnetic base on a vertical steel plate shall be sufficient to hold the superstructure rigidly in place during operation. 3.2.4.1 Column and
16、crossarm. The column shall be attached to the base and shail support the crossarm. The crossarm shaii move along its lengthwise axis, move along the crossarm, and swivel about the column. Movement of the crossarm along its lengthwise axis or along the column shall be by means of a clamp, leadscrew,
17、or rack and pinion as specified (see 7.2(g). Unless otherwise specified (see 7.2(h), minimum crossarm axial and column travels shall be as shown in tables I and II for type II and type III metal disintegrators, respectively. 3.2.5 Worktable. The type III metal disintegrator shall be equipped with a
18、worktable. Th; worktable shall support the workpiece, the superstructure, and the vibrating head. Unless otherwise specified (see 7.2(i). the dimensions of the worktable shall not be less than 20 inches by 18 inches. Unless otherwise specified (see 7.2(j), the worktable distributed load capacity sha
